Same Pitch, Different Note Name. Several notes share the same pitch but have different names. For example, A flat is the same pitch as G sharp, and C sharp is the same pitch as D flat.

WebMar 9, 2024 · Chord Symbol: C♯m. The C♯ minor triad consists of a root (C♯), third (E), and fifth (G♯). The distance between the root and the third is a minor third interval (or three half-steps), and the distance between the third and the fifth is a major third interval (or four half-steps). Minor triads have a “sad” sound.
